AN élite squad of swimmers from Camden Swiss Cottage went head-to-head against some of the very best competition the country has to offer at the weekend.

The top team travelled to Millfield School in Somerset for the 2014 Amateur Swimming Association South Zonal Meet.

Among the top performers was Isobel Moffatt (pictured), who scooped a silver medal in the 50m butterfly, agonisingly missing the British Championships Qualifying Time by just 0.01 of a second. The 15-year-old also powered home to a fifth-place finish in the 100m butterfly.

Club-mate Indigo Mathews, 14, put in a strong performance in the 200m freestyle, taking a bronze medal in 2.11.79. Showing great versatility, Indigo also took fifth place in the 400m individual medley and sixth spot in the 200m backstroke.

Maddy Hookway, 14, finished just off the podium in fourth place in the 100m breaststroke in a personal best time of 1.17.90. Maddy also sprinted strongly to take fifth place in another impressive new best time in the 50m breaststroke.

Also putting in notable performances were Bryce Puszet, 15, and Andrew Garcia, 14, who both recorded personal best times in their respective 200m and 50m freestyle events.

Reflecting on the successful outing, head coach Tim Hartley said: “I was pleased with the form this early in the season and we had a good number of really strong swims. We’re in a tough training period and all the indicators at this stage are very positive.”
